Receiving variable length packets through a com port in Simulink using SLDRT package
Mostrar comentarios más antiguos
Hi,
In my application I am simulating in Simulink Desktop Realtime (SLDRT) environment and trying to use "packet output" and "packet input" blocks available in the SLDRT package to send and receive through a com port. But the issue is that the packet lengths are not fixed for both Tx and Rx. I have found a way to get around this limitation for Tx, using multiple "packet output" blocks executed based on a switch case logic.
for Rx (i.e., packet input) can`t use the same method as the other device that I am trying to communicate with does not send the packet length within the packet itself. packet format uses a startring and end sequence with possible byte stuffing. To make matters hard, the device can even send multiple messages within one iteration of the simulation.
Is there any workaroud / solution to this problem ?
